Synopsis
Animated 2002 short film produced by Studio Ghibli for their near exclusive use in the Ghibli Museum. It features famous director Miyazaki Hayao himself as narrator (in the form of a humanoid pig, reminiscent of Porco from Porco Rosso), telling the story of flight and the many machines imagined to achieve it. Note: The film could also be seen on the in-flight entertainment system used by Japan Airlines. (Source: AniDB)
